Jimmie Jeff Rutherford

September 29, 1932 — May 2, 2019

Jimmie Jeff Rutherford passed away on May 2, 2019 at the age of 86 in McKinney, TX. Jimmie was born to Jeff and Irene Rutherford on September 29, 1932 in Ponca City, OK. He was a graduate of the University of New Mexico in 1957 and proudly served his country in the Korean Conflict in 1953 to 1954.

He married Nona Mae Wallace on October 14, 1955 and they made their home in Albuquerque, NM where they had two children. They also resided in Centrerville, MD, El Paso, TX, Las Cruces, NM and McKinney, TX.

Jimmie was a Certified Public Accountant who started his career with Peat Marwick Mitchell in 1956 and went on to work for United Nuclear Corporation from 1963 to 1964, Elmer Fox and Company from 1970 to 1976 where he was a partner. He then starting the accounting firm Bock Rutherford and Company with his partner, John Bock in 1976. He retired full time in 2002. A lifelong member of the Baptist church he served faithfully as a deacon and in many other volunteer positions. His faith was an integral part of his life.
